Question 537: To ask the Minister for the Environment, Heritage and Local Government if he will authorise, approve and fund the proposed Balyna group water scheme in County Kildare in the near future; the procedures expected to delay the scheme;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[42893/06]
Dick Roche (Wicklow,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context
Responsibility for the administration of the Rural Water Programme, including the prioritisation, approval and payment of grants to group schemes, has been devolved to county councils since 1997.
